小人物學(xué)個大習(xí)(81-90)
C++ primer
decltype(a=b) d=a;若i為int,表達(dá)式i=x的返回類型為int&,并且()內(nèi)的函數(shù)并不會被調(diào)用
struct數(shù)據(jù)結(jié)構(gòu),包含類名和類體
struct 類名 {成員變量1=初始值;成員變量2 = 初始值;};
struct 類名 {} 該類型變量1,該類型變量2;調(diào)用struct里的成員變量的方法
類名.成員變量為了多次包含相同頭文件且仍然能夠安全工作,常用的技術(shù)是預(yù)處理器#
頭文件保護(hù)符,#ifndef 頭文件
#define 頭文件
#endif
通過這樣的方式確保相同的頭文件只編譯一次使用using聲明來使用命名空間中的變量
using namespace::name;頭文件中不應(yīng)包含using聲明,因?yàn)檫@會導(dǎo)致包含該頭文件的文件都有了這個聲明
標(biāo)準(zhǔn)庫類型string,string表示可變長的字符序列,使用string 類型必須必須首先包含string頭文件
初始化string對象的3種特殊方法
string s1(s2);
string s3(“value”);
string s4(n,‘c’);給s4賦值n個c讀寫stirng對象,cin>>S,這里會將string對象讀入S但是遇到空白會停止,cout同理
因?yàn)椴幌雽W(xué),所以才要學(xué)。
2023年7月6日
標(biāo)簽: